Technical Specifications: Key Quality Parameters

Parameter Specification Details
Material Composition High-density vitrified ceramic (water absorption < 0.5%), premium-grade kaolin clay, alumina reinforcement for durability. Glaze: lead-free, acid-resistant, C1/C2 class per ISO 13006.
Tolerances Dimensional tolerance: ±1.5 mm on critical fit points (e.g., bowl outlet, mounting holes). Surface flatness: ≤ 0.8 mm/m². Water outlet alignment: ±1 mm.
Firing Process Single or double firing at 1200–1280°C. Double-firing preferred for higher strength and glaze integrity.
Hydraulic Performance Toilet flush efficiency: 4.8L full flush, 3.0L half flush (dual-flush compliant). Flow rate: ±5% of rated volume.
Mechanical Strength Minimum compressive strength: 22 MPa. Load-bearing capacity: ≥440 kg (seating area).
Surface Finish Gloss level: 85–95 GU (gloss units). No pinholes, crazing, or orange peel effect.

Common Quality Defects & Prevention Strategies

Common Quality Defect Description Root Cause Prevention Strategy
Cracking (Thermal/Mechanical) Hairline or structural cracks in bowl or tank Rapid temperature change, inadequate drying, or poor kiln control Implement controlled drying (≤48 hrs), uniform heating/cooling profiles, and pre-stress testing
Crazing Fine network of cracks in glaze surface Mismatch in thermal expansion between body and glaze Use glaze formulated for thermal compatibility; conduct thermal shock testing (ISO 10545-9)
Pinholing Small holes in glaze surface exposing ceramic body Organic impurities, trapped air, or over-firing Purify raw materials; optimize glaze viscosity; control firing atmosphere
Dimensional Inaccuracy Misaligned mounting holes or outlet Mold wear, poor calibration, or shrinkage variation Conduct bi-weekly mold metrology; use laser alignment systems; monitor shrinkage rates
Water Leakage (Toilet Tank/Bowl) Seepage at joints or base Poor sealing surface, casting voids, or faulty gaskets Pressure test at 0.6 MPa for 60 sec; inspect sealing surfaces with profilometer
Glaze Blisters Raised bubbles in fired glaze Contamination or trapped gases during firing De-air pug mill clay; ensure complete glaze drying pre-firing
Color Variation Inconsistent glaze color across batches Raw material inconsistency or kiln temperature gradients Standardize pigment sourcing; install thermocouples for zonal kiln monitoring
Chipping at Edges Breakage on rim, seat mount, or corners Weak structural design or impact during handling Reinforce high-stress zones; use edge rounding; implement protective packaging
Poor Flush Performance Incomplete evacuation or clogging Incorrect trapway design or hydraulic imbalance Conduct hydraulic flow testing with ISO 3050 standard; optimize trapway contour
Efflorescence White salt deposits on surface Soluble alkali in clay reacting with moisture Pre-wash raw materials; use flux modifiers to bind alkalis; store finished goods in dry conditions

WHITE LABEL VS. PRIVATE LABEL: STRATEGIC COMPARISON

Critical Differentiators for Procurement Strategy

Factor White Label Private Label Procurement Recommendation
Definition Rebranding of supplier’s existing catalog products Co-developed products with exclusive specs/design Private Label preferred for brand differentiation
MOQ Flexibility Low (500–1,000 units) Moderate (1,000–5,000 units) White Label for test markets; PL for core lines
Unit Cost 8–12% lower base price 15–20% higher setup, 3–8% lower long-term PL breaks even at ~8,000 units
Lead Time Shorter (30–45 days) Longer (+15–25 days for tooling/R&D) White Label for urgent replenishment
IP Ownership Supplier retains IP Buyer owns final product IP PL essential for patent protection
Customization Depth Limited (color/trim only) Full (materials, ergonomics, tech) PL required for competitive moats
Quality Risk Higher (shared production lines) Lower (dedicated lines + joint QC) PL reduces field failure rates by 22% (SCM Digest 2025)

Strategic Insight: 68% of top-tier global brands now use hybrid models (White Label for accessories, Private Label for core fixtures) to balance speed-to-market with margin protection. Avoid White Label for regulated markets (e.g., NA/EU) due to compliance liability risks.

How to Distinguish Between Trading Company and Factory

Indicator Factory Trading Company
Facility Ownership Owns land/building; visible production lines (kilns, casting, glazing) No production equipment. Office-only or shared warehouse.
Staff Structure Employs in-house engineers, mold designers, and QC technicians Staff focused on sales, logistics, and negotiation.
Pricing Transparency Provides BOM (Bill of Materials) and cost breakdown per unit Quotes FOB prices without process details.
Lead Times Offers realistic production schedules based on machine capacity May quote shorter lead times but delays occur due to subcontracting.
Customization Capability Can modify molds, glaze colors, and technical specs in-house Limited to catalog items or minor modifications via supplier.
Website & Marketing Features factory tours, machinery, and R&D labs Focuses on product catalogs, certifications, and “global distribution.”
Export History Direct export licenses (self-declaration) and customs records Relies on freight forwarders; no direct export history.

Pro Tip: Use Baidu Maps or Alibaba Street View to inspect facility size and infrastructure. Factories typically occupy >10,000 sqm with visible loading docks and kiln chimneys.


Red Flags to Avoid in Sanitary Ware Sourcing

Red Flag Risk Recommended Action
Unwillingness to conduct video audit Likely not a real factory or hiding subpar conditions Insist on live video walkthrough of production floor and QC lab.
No ISO 9001, ISO 14001, or OHSAS 18001 Poor process control, environmental, and safety management Require certification copies verified via certification body website.
Only offers Alibaba Trade Assurance May be a middleman leveraging platform protection Treat as a starting point, not validation. Proceed with on-site audit.
Requests full prepayment High fraud risk Use LC at sight or 30% deposit with 70% against B/L copy.
Multiple unrelated product lines (e.g., sanitary ware + electronics) Likely a trader aggregating suppliers Focus on specialists with >80% revenue from ceramics or bathroom fixtures.
No in-house mold-making capability Reliant on external suppliers; delays in customization Confirm mold workshop with CNC machines and 3D design software (e.g., AutoCAD, SolidWorks).
Avoids discussion of raw material sourcing Risk of inconsistent quality or substandard clay/glaze Request supplier list for feldspar, kaolin, and glaze chemicals.
